Output 8c31b77315b8f1f7b52f7c42984504df3642cdf0a9f98c4ae7506ad95bf3617e:0

value
23177620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4fa4864a1eae413bfd759e7a4867a98c5d17ce3 OP_EQUALVERIFY OP_CHECKSIG
address
1JxXGYzUPFPeCWJTAf5AsNmExmK3vvs3y8
transaction
8c31b77315b8f1f7b52f7c42984504df3642cdf0a9f98c4ae7506ad95bf3617e
spent
true